化学预处理磷石膏用于水泥缓凝剂的研究 被引量:25

摘要 分别用不同浓度的石灰溶液、氨水和柠檬酸溶液预处理磷石膏,测试预处理磷石膏的杂质质量分数及DTA曲线.将预处理磷石膏掺入水泥熟料作缓凝剂磨制水泥,对所制水泥的凝结时间及抗压强度进行测试,结果表明,柠檬酸对磷石膏的杂质去除效果较好,其预处理的磷石膏作为水泥缓凝剂,效果与天然石膏相当.石灰溶液中和法虽是常推荐使用的磷石膏预处理方法,但与柠檬酸溶液预处理法相比,石灰中和磷石膏作缓凝剂的效果并不理想.
